lobal Biological Molluscicide Market Report Description


The Global Biological Molluscicide Market was valued at USD 700 million in 2023 and is projected to surpass USD 1.3 billion by 2031, growing at a robust CAGR of 8.1% during the forecast period from 2023 to 2031. The rising demand for eco-friendly pest control solutions, increasing agricultural productivity, and growing concerns about the environmental impact of synthetic molluscicides are driving the market's growth. Biological molluscicides, derived from natural sources, are gaining popularity due to their sustainable and less toxic nature, ensuring the safety of non-target organisms and soil health.

Drivers:

Rising Demand for Sustainable Agriculture: The growing need for organic farming and sustainable crop protection is a key driver. Farmers are increasingly adopting biological molluscicides to comply with stringent regulations on chemical pesticide use.

Environmental Concerns: Synthetic molluscicides contribute to soil and water contamination. Biological alternatives reduce ecological footprints, appealing to environmentally conscious stakeholders.

Government Support and Regulations: Policies promoting sustainable farming practices and the use of biopesticides are creating favorable conditions for market growth.

Restraints:

High Production Costs: The cost of developing and manufacturing biological molluscicides is higher compared to chemical alternatives, which could limit their widespread adoption.

Limited Shelf Life: Biological products typically have a shorter shelf life, which poses a challenge for distribution and storage.

Opportunity:

Technological Advancements: Ongoing research and innovation in microbial and botanical formulations offer significant potential for market expansion.

Emerging Markets: Countries in Asia-Pacific and Africa, where agriculture is a key sector, present untapped opportunities for biological molluscicides.

Market Insights:

By System Type:

The Botanical-Based Molluscicides segment dominated the market in 2023 due to their efficiency and safety for use in organic farming. Microbial-based molluscicides are also expected to witness substantial growth, driven by advancements in microbial technology.

By End-Use:

The Agriculture sector held the largest market share in 2023, with increasing adoption in fruit and vegetable crops. The horticulture segment is poised for rapid growth as urban and rooftop gardening trends gain momentum.

By Regional Insights:

North America led the market in 2023, supported by high awareness and adoption of sustainable agricultural practices.

Asia-Pacific is projected to register the highest CAGR during the forecast period due to increasing agricultural activities and government support for biopesticides in countries like India and China.

Competitive Scenario:

Key players in the market include Marrone Bio Innovations, BASF SE, Lonza Group, Certis USA LLC, and De Sangosse SAS. These companies are focusing on expanding their product portfolios, strategic acquisitions, and partnerships to enhance market presence. For example:

In 2023, Marrone Bio Innovations launched a new microbial-based molluscicide targeting key pest species.

De Sangosse SAS announced its expansion in the Asia-Pacific market through strategic partnerships in 2024.
